Typical light sources involve deuterium lamps, tungsten lamps, and mercury lamps. Samples are typically held in quartz or glass cuvettes. Detectors consist of phototubes and photodiodes. 300 to 2000 grooves for each mm is usable for UV-Vis spectroscopy needs but a minimum of 1200 grooves per mm is typical. The quality of the spectroscopic measurements is delicate to Actual physical imperfections from the diffraction grating and within the optical setup. Like a consequence, dominated diffraction gratings are likely to own far more defects than blazed holographic diffraction gratings.three Blazed holographic diffraction gratings are inclined to deliver noticeably far better excellent measurements.three

Photomultiplier Tube: The photomultiplier tube stands as a well known detector in contemporary UV-Vis spectrophotometers. Its framework comprises an anode, cathode, and several dynodes. Any time a photon enters the tube, it strikes the cathode, resulting in the emission of electrons. These electrons are subsequently accelerated to the primary dynode, leading to the manufacture of a number of electrons.
